Aerospace and Tooling Market in the United Kingdom
The Aerospace and tooling market is a major part of both commercial and defense aviation. It includes the design, manufacturing, and maintenance of aircraft systems, all of which depend on precision tooling. These tools include jigs, fixtures, molds, and other instruments used to assemble and maintain airframes, engines, and avionics. They help maintain strict accuracy and reliability standards required by modern aviation. As advanced materials and digital manufacturing methods grow, tooling continues to evolve to support higher precision and better productivity.

Industry Ecosystem in the UK Aerospace and Tooling Market
The United Kingdom has a strong aerospace industrial base that includes major companies such as BAE Systems, Rolls-Royce, and Airbus. These firms work with many small and medium-sized enterprises that provide specialized tooling solutions. Government programs that support digitalization, artificial intelligence, autonomous technologies, and green aviation also strengthen the ecosystem. Sustainability initiatives encourage the development of efficient engines and alternative propulsion systems. Tooling adapts to these needs by supporting composite materials, additive manufacturing, and automated production lines.

Defense Requirements in the UK Aerospace and Tooling Market
Defense aviation is another major driver in the aerospace and tooling market in the United Kingdom. Tooling supports the production of fighter aircraft, transport planes, drones, and missile systems. These tools must meet extreme performance requirements, especially for stealth structures, advanced avionics, and precision weapon systems. Defense platforms often need quick upgrades or retrofits, so tooling must be flexible and scalable. Close partnerships among defense contractors and suppliers ensure that tooling innovations support national security needs and advanced military capabilities.
